LAW OF COSINES:

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

For any DABC, where a ,b ,and c are the lengths of the sides of the triangle opposite the

angles with measures A, B, and C respectively:

 

a2 = b2 + c2 – 2bc(cos A)   &   b2 = a2 + c2 – 2ac(cos B)   &   c2 = a2 + b2 – 2ab(cos C)
